What is a Percent Solution?

A percent solution is a way of expressing the concentration of a solution. It indicates the amount of solute (the substance being dissolved) in a certain amount of solvent (the substance in which the solute is dissolved). Percent solutions can be expressed in three main ways:

  1. Weight/Volume Percent (w/v%): This is the most common type of percent solution and is used when the solute is a solid and the solvent is a liquid. It represents the mass of the solute in grams per 100 mL of solution.
  2. Volume/Volume Percent (v/v%): This type is used when both the solute and solvent are liquids. It represents the volume of the solute in mL per 100 mL of solution.
  3. Weight/Weight Percent (w/w%): This is used when both the solute and solvent are solids or when precise mass measurements are needed. It represents the mass of the solute in grams per 100 grams of solution.

Practical Applications

In the Laboratory

In scientific research and laboratory settings, percent solutions are frequently used to prepare reagents, buffers, and other solutions. Accurate concentration is crucial for experimental reproducibility and reliability. A percent solution calculator ensures that your solutions are prepared correctly, reducing the risk of errors that could impact your results.

In Cooking and Food Preparation

Chefs and food scientists often use percent solutions to create brines, marinades, and other culinary solutions. A percent solution calculator can help achieve the desired flavor and texture by ensuring the correct concentration of ingredients.

In Healthcare

Pharmacists and healthcare professionals use percent solutions to prepare medications and intravenous fluids. Accurate concentration is essential for patient safety and treatment efficacy. A percent solution calculator assists in preparing the correct dosages, minimizing the risk of errors.
